

A fearless digital entrepreneur and transgender advocate who built a beauty empire from her YouTube bedroom.
Nikita Dragun rewrote the rules of influence by centering her transgender identity not as a sidebar, but as the core of her glamorous, unapologetic brand. Starting with makeup tutorials on YouTube, she documented her transition with a level of transparency and polish that was unprecedented, amassing millions of followers who were drawn to her confidence and artistry. She leveraged that platform to launch Dragun Beauty, a cosmetics line specifically designed to address the needs of the transgender community, like color-correcting kits, while appealing to a broad audience. Her life, chronicled across social media, is a high-production blend of fashion, beauty, and candid personal moments, challenging stereotypes and expanding visibility. While her career has navigated public controversy, her impact is undeniable: she carved out a lucrative space in the beauty industry by speaking directly to an underserved community and proving that identity could be a powerful foundation for empire.

She is of Vietnamese and Mexican descent.
She starred in her own reality series, 'Nikita Unfiltered', on YouTube Originals.
Her birth name is Nikita Nguyen; she chose the professional surname 'Dragun' as a personal brand.
